Man charged with murder after woman dies from gunshot wound
Richard Basson, 44, will appear in court on Monday.

A man has been charged with murder after a woman died from a gunshot wound.
Carrie Slater, 37, was found with serious injuries on Thursday in Kings Road, Long Clawson, near Melton Mowbray in Leicestershire, and died in hospital on Saturday evening, Leicestershire Police said.
Richard Basson, of the same address, was arrested and has now been charged with murder, possessing a prohibited weapon of a length less than 30/60cm and possessing ammunition without a certificate.
The 44-year-old will appear at Leicester Magistratesā Court on Monday.
A post-mortem examination found that Ms Slater had died from a gunshot wound.

In a statement released on Sunday, her family said: āCarrie was loved by all of us. She was a daughter and beloved sister to her siblings.
āWeāre still coming to terms with what happened. Itās difficult to put into words how weāre feeling but nothing we say is going to bring her back.
āShe grew up in Grantham and we know there are people there who will be devastated to learn that sheās no longer with us.
āWeāre supporting one another as we grieve and ask for privacy at this time.ā
Police said no-one else is being sought in connection with the incident, but reassurance patrols will be carried out in the area.
